タグ

web開発とjavascriptに関するstealthinuのブックマーク (57)

  • 動かして学ぶ!Vue.js開発入門 | 翔泳社

    Vue.js(ビュージェイエス)とは】 Vue.jsは、Webアプリ開発用のJavaScriptフレームワークです。 比較的小規模の開発から利用でき、さらにWebアプリ開発で主流になりつつある、 シングルページアプリケーション(SPA)を構築することもできるため、 Web開発で大人気のフレームワークです。 【書の概要】 Vue.jsの基機能を押さえたサンプルを元に、Webアプリ開発手法を学ぶことができます。 具体的には、ニーズの高い、データバインディング、イベント、ライブラリの利用、コンポーネントなど 開発の現場でニーズの高いトピックを中心に解説。 さらに現在、主流になりつつあるSPAの作成に役立つポイントも盛り込みます。 【ターゲット】 フロントエンドエンジニア初心者 【著者】 森巧尚(もり・よしなお) この世にパソコンが誕生したばかりの時代からミニゲームを作り続けて30数年。 現

    動かして学ぶ!Vue.js開発入門 | 翔泳社
    stealthinu
    stealthinu 2021/09/07
     Vue.jsJR-100  

    web

    javascript
     
  • シニアフロントエンド開発者みたいにChromeデベロッパーツールを使おう - Qiita


    Chrome12 Photo by Morning Brew on Unsplash Chrome ConsoleElementsDOMCSS Chrome 便 ChromeCommandChromeCommandLinuxShellChrome
    シニアフロントエンド開発者みたいにChromeデベロッパーツールを使おう - Qiita
    stealthinu
    stealthinu 2021/04/07
    Chromeのデベロッパーツール、思ってたよりもいろんな知らない機能があった。「$_」が特別な変数として使えるのはperl文化からきてるのかな?
  • すべてをjsにまとめる思想を理解する - webpackハンズオンシリーズ|こんぴゅ


    javascriptsasstypescriptminifyautoprefixerbundle webpackwebpackjsgulpbrowserifynpm script jscsshtmljs webpackloaderjs
    すべてをjsにまとめる思想を理解する - webpackハンズオンシリーズ|こんぴゅ
    stealthinu
    stealthinu 2018/03/19
    webpack使ってCSSや画像までもJSで一括して扱ってしまうという手法
  • 新QiitaでReactをやめてhyperappを採用した背景 - Qiita


    12/1 Qiita React 使 hyperapp  React  hyperapp      hyperapp  TL;DR  React  hyperapp    DOM 
    新QiitaでReactをやめてhyperappを採用した背景 - Qiita
    stealthinu
    stealthinu 2017/12/28
    これブ米読むと単にWebフレームワークアーキテクチャの問題じゃない、人間が絡むもっと深い問題なんだなってわかって勉強になった。Vueくらいがちょうどよい感があるから流行ってるのかな?
  • ヘッドレスChromeの自動化ツール「Chromeless」を使って自動テストを実施する #serverless #adventcalendar | DevelopersIO


    ChromeChromeless使 #serverless #adventcalendar Chrome Google Chrome59GUIDOM Chrome  Chrome   |  Web  |  Google Developers  Chrome
    ヘッドレスChromeの自動化ツール「Chromeless」を使って自動テストを実施する #serverless #adventcalendar | DevelopersIO
    stealthinu
    stealthinu 2017/12/25
    今後はphantomjs使う代わりにchromelessを使うようにすればいいのかな?
  • CORSリクエストでクレデンシャル(≒クッキー)を必要とする場合の注意点 - Qiita

    クレデンシャルの送信 クロスオリジンのAJAXリクエストでクレデンシャル(クッキーの送信またはBASIC認証)を必要とする場合は、それを許可するオプションをフロント側Javascriptで付けておく必要があります。デフォルトではCORSリクエストでクッキーは送信されませんし、BASIC認証は送れません。 Fetch API の場合 fetch(url, { mode: 'cors', //クロスオリジンリクエストをするのでCORSモードにする credentials: 'include' //クレデンシャルを含める指定 })

    CORSリクエストでクレデンシャル(≒クッキー)を必要とする場合の注意点 - Qiita
    stealthinu
    stealthinu 2017/04/06
    クロスオリジンでアクセスする(CORS)のための.htaccessの設定方法について
  • JavaScript ベスト・オブ・ザ・イヤー 2016


    JavaScript 2016 2016 12 Github 2016 2015 React Flux  Redux  2016JavaScript 
    stealthinu
    stealthinu 2017/01/27
    javascript界隈の2016のトレンド。勉強する前に時代遅れになってしまったものがいくつか… しかしVue.jsが生き残ったのは意外だった。ReactとAngularに殺されるかと思ってたから。Vue.jsはシンプルでいいよね。
  • httpOnlyなCookieとは? - それマグで!


    WebkitCookie調 HTTP  Cookie name , value, domain , path, expires , size ,http , secure  (cookie) expires  path/domain  secure  HTTPS使Cookie  http  secure  secure / http   http  HTTP 使Cookie 
    httpOnlyなCookieとは? - それマグで!
    stealthinu
    stealthinu 2016/11/29
     httponlyjavascript  

    javascript

    security

    web
     
  • jQuery.ajaxの代わりにSuperAgentを使う - Qiita


    jQuery AngularJSVue.jsDOM jQueryAJAX使 AJAXjQuery AJAXSuperAgent HTTP Node.js使 Express, StylusTJ superagent   URLsuperagent.js https://wzrd.in/standalone/superagent@latest scriptsuperag
    jQuery.ajaxの代わりにSuperAgentを使う - Qiita
    stealthinu
    stealthinu 2016/08/01
    jQuery.ajaxのかわりにそこだけをやるためのライブラリ。SuperAgent
  • JavaScriptを劇的に教えやすくするWebサーバ作りました - Qiita


    JavaScript73Gulp, Babel, Sass, PostCSS, WebPack, Rollup, Browserify ...!   JavaScriptCSSWebFelt (2016/7/19 ) GitHub: https://github.com/cognitom/felt npm: https://www.npmjs.com/package/
    JavaScriptを劇的に教えやすくするWebサーバ作りました - Qiita
    stealthinu
    stealthinu 2016/07/27
    Web開発でJavascriptなどのトランスパイラ等ツールの動作をひとつにまとめてやってくれるラッパー。ほんとに全部自動で出来るならいいような気がする。
  • 春からはじめるモダンJavaScript / ES2015 - Qiita


     JavaScriptES2015 JavaScript JavaScript 2016ES2016ES2015ES2015ES5 () NetScape/IE6 (1996~2005) ES3: 7
    春からはじめるモダンJavaScript / ES2015 - Qiita
    stealthinu
    stealthinu 2016/06/01
    ES2015のおさえておくところとなぜES2015が作られたのかの歴史。これ読んで色々とすっきりまとまった。
  • Babelで始める!モダンJavaScript開発

    Babelは最低限の機能をIE8以降で、フル機能をIE10以降でサポートします。 (実際にはIE9以降から使用することを推奨します) 当初Babelは6to5と呼ばれていましたが、ECMAScript7の仕様なども取り込むようになったため、バージョンを想定しないBabelという名前に変更されました。 Babelの特徴 Babelと同じように「トランスパイルすることでJavaScriptのコードを出力する」ツールにはTypeScriptやCoffeeScriptなどがあります。 それらと比較するとBabelは「ECMAScript標準仕様をベースにしている(*)」という特徴があります。 (*) 実際にはJSXもサポートしているため、必ずしもECMAScript標準仕様のみをサポートしているわけではありません。 このため、「いずれ標準実装される仕様を先取りできる」、「Babel自体が廃れても同

    Babelで始める!モダンJavaScript開発
    stealthinu
    stealthinu 2016/05/24
    Babelまだ使ったことないので… しかしBabelの開発始まったの2014/9でこの紹介記事だって2015/10、で2016/5でまだ使ったことないとヤバイ感。Webフロントエンド系の流速が早過ぎる…
  • HTTP/1.1 200 OK - Qiita


      planetter.com 3  Atom IDEEclipse使IDEWebStorm使 AtomIDE()
    HTTP/1.1 200 OK - Qiita
    stealthinu
    stealthinu 2016/05/11
       

    web



    javascript
     
  • あのライブラリは何故誕生したの?のまとめ - Qiita


      nobkz ? ? - nobkz   "How?(使)"  "Why?()"    
    あのライブラリは何故誕生したの?のまとめ - Qiita
    stealthinu
    stealthinu 2016/04/13
    これはすごくわかりやすいまとめだった。Webフロントエンド系をメインでやってないと新しく出てきたツールについて、これなんのためのツールなんだろ?ってよくなる。
  • 10年のツケを支払ったフロント界隈におけるJavaScript開発環境(2016年4月現在)。 - 日々、とんは語る。


    2015CSS1012016  React + Redux + react-router + material-ui + axios + ES2015 + Babel + webpack + ESLint + Airbnb JavaScript Style Guide JavaScript  ReactAJavaScript library for building user interfaces | React React
    10年のツケを支払ったフロント界隈におけるJavaScript開発環境(2016年4月現在)。 - 日々、とんは語る。
    stealthinu
    stealthinu 2016/04/04
    Webフロントエンド系はほんとに流れ早いな。ちょっと前まではAnglarが、とか言ってたのにもうこうなったか。2年後にはまただいぶ変わってるのだろう。もしくは「Web界隈」が主戦場ではなくなってるか。
  • TechCrunch | Startup and Technology News

    Boeing’s Starliner spacecraft has successfully delivered two astronauts to the International Space Station, a key milestone in the aerospace giant’s quest to certify the capsule for regular crewed missions.  Starliner…

    TechCrunch | Startup and Technology News
    stealthinu
    stealthinu 2015/06/18
    これいいじゃん。結局JSが標準言語と確率されAltJSがJSを「アセンブラ」として使うようになったからアセンブル後の中間言語を標準化し、他の言語もその中間言語を吐くようにするべってことだよね。
  • Google Codeの閉鎖に伴い、設置済みajaxzip3が2016年1月死亡確定。引き続き利用するにはjsの読み込みをgithubに変更が必要。 - motooLogue


    Google Codeajaxzip320161jsgithub 2015 3/30 Google Bidding farewell to Google Code Beginning today, we have disabled new project creation on Google Code. We will be shutting down the service about 10 months from now on January 25th, 2016. Below, we provide links to migration tools designed to help you move
    Google Codeの閉鎖に伴い、設置済みajaxzip3が2016年1月死亡確定。引き続き利用するにはjsの読み込みをgithubに変更が必要。 - motooLogue
    stealthinu
    stealthinu 2015/06/15
    これはハマる。ajaxzip3がgoogle code停止のためgithubへ移行とのこと。
  • HTML-encoding lost when attribute read from input field

    I’m using JavaScript to pull a value out from a hidden field and display it in a textbox. The value in the hidden field is encoded. For example, <input id='hiddenId' type='hidden' value='chalk &amp; cheese' /> gets pulled into <input type='text' value='chalk &amp; cheese' /> via some jQuery to get the value from the hidden field (it’s at this point that I lose the encoding): $('#hiddenId').attr('v

    HTML-encoding lost when attribute read from input field
    stealthinu
    stealthinu 2015/05/21
    jQuery使ったHTMLエスケープ手法『$('<div/>').html(val).text()』は少し問題があるらしくAngularJSのsanitize.jsのencodeEntitiesメソッドだとUnicodeのことも考慮されてるし良いとのこと。
  • ブラウザ内で50万件のテーブルもサクサクで表示できるようにする「Clusterize.js」:phpspot開発日誌


    Clusterize.js 50Clusterize.js DOM50使50 DOM50DOM 便  jQueryWATable Google Charts使Chartinator HTML JSONXMLPNGCSVPDFHTMLtable Export 
    stealthinu
    stealthinu 2015/05/07
    一気にデータを送っておいてページネーションは全部ブラウザ任せという設計に出来るのか。
  • GitHub - posabsolute/jQuery-Validation-Engine: jQuery form validation plugin

    jQuery.validationEngine v3.1.0 Looking for official contributors This project has now been going on for more than 7 years, right now I only maintain the project through pull request contributions. However, I would love to have help improving the code quality and maintain an acceptable level of open issues. Summary jQuery validation engine is a Javascript plugin aimed at the validation of form fiel

    GitHub - posabsolute/jQuery-Validation-Engine: jQuery form validation plugin
    stealthinu
    stealthinu 2015/04/28
    バリデーションを行ってくれるjQueryプラグイン。自分でルール書いたり専用関数呼び出したり出来るなど柔軟性が高い。